自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(25)
  • 收藏
  • 关注

转载 ping与 telnet的区别

转自:https://blog.csdn.net/qq_26878363/article/details/82493254ping与 telnet的区别 ping: 用来检查网络是否通畅或网络连接速度(Ping域名可以得出解析IP) telnet: 用来检查指定ip是否开放指定端口的 说明:Ping不通并不一定代表网络不通。ping是基于ICMP协议的命令,就是你发出去一个数...

2019-08-27 17:42:30 303

转载 springboot 进行热部署

原文参考地址:https://blog.csdn.net/qq_37598011/article/details/807789151.在pom.xml中添加依赖<!-- 热部署 --> <!-- devtools可以实现页面热部署(即页面修改后会立即生效, 这个可以直接在application.properties文件中配置spri...

2019-05-13 09:51:52 202

原创 解析button和input type=button 的区别

很简单,就一句话。button按钮在form表单的时候会当成submit提交,千万不要再当作button用了,如果想用button就用input type=“button" 来搞。

2019-05-08 10:56:39 240

原创 java中时间戳与日期相互转换

long timeStamp = System.currentTimeMillis();//获取当前时间戳(这是毫秒时间戳)SimpleDateFormat sdf=new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");//这个是你要转成后的时间的格式String sd = sdf.format(new Date(timeStamp)); // 时间戳转...

2019-04-10 08:43:18 4161

原创 Apache限制访问某目录或某文件

1.问题:之前项目的每间隔一段时间执行的脚本,或者定时执行的脚本(例如每天结算利息),都放到了TP框架外,例如collect目录中,如果没有限制Apache访问这些目录和文件,意味着别人可以通过了浏览器访问这些文件,造成数据混乱,很不安全。2.解决办法:(1)限制访问项目的某个目录和某个文件。&lt;Directory "D:\code_flower\php\flower\co...

2018-12-15 14:04:24 2056

原创 mysql权限在项目中的使用

1.问题:之前项目的config文件数据库链接,都是使用的root直接连接数据库,权限太大,可以对其他项目的数据库进行操作,需要改为只对这个项目的数据库具有操作权限的用户进行操作。2.解决办法:(1)创建只对这个项目数据库具有操作权限的用户。grant all privileges on flower.* to flower_user@'%' identified by "...

2018-12-12 11:44:54 134

原创 部署服务器需要开启和注意的地方

1 mysql 相关问题:本地数据库里面有innodb,导致往线上到数据报错导入不完全解决:把my.ini里面skip-innodb的加上注释# skip-innodb问题:重启MySQL后,事件停止。解决:在my.ini中开启事件event_scheduler = on2Apache相关问题:打开mpm模块解决:去掉Include conf/extra/httpd-...

2018-10-18 11:51:08 254

原创 微信分享我的好友,分享朋友圈需要注意的问题

首先我明确的一点是,要实现微信分享我的好友,分享朋友圈需要两个步骤(1)前端js调用(2)后台参数等设置。第一部分:前端js调用    第一部分十分简单,按照微信公众平台的手册去做,就没有问题。

2017-07-17 11:52:26 1001

转载 Flex 布局教程:语法篇

作者: 阮一峰日期: 2015年7月10日网页布局(layout)是 CSS 的一个重点应用。布局的传统解决方案,基于盒状模型,依赖 display 属性 + position属性 + float属性。它对于那些特殊布局非常不方便,比如,垂直居中就不容易实现。2009年,W3C 提出了一种新的方案----Flex 布局,可以简便、完整

2017-06-03 15:45:30 279

原创 微信小程序demo1计算器

一 微信小程序开发工具界面二 目录结构第一次进到页面它的目录结构如下:三 需要注意的问题(1)添加的新页面文件,都需要在app.json中进行配置,否则页面报错。(2)工作原理  通过在中添加事件 bindtap="btnClick" id="{{n9}}"   相当于click事件。在js代码中,可以通过this.data.n9获取数据,这些数据的

2017-06-01 17:03:41 6369 2

转载 【WEB开发】JavaScript中的立即执行函数表达式(IIFE)

立即执行函数表达式(Immediately-Invoked Function Expression), 还有其他的名字:自执行匿名函数(self-executing anonymous function)。 接触到这个IIFE,最早就是为了解决闭包时造成的问题。还记得我们上一篇Blog, JavaScript中的闭包(closure)中的例子么?123456789101

2017-02-22 16:35:49 274

转载 【WEB开发】JavaScript中的闭包(closure)

之前在写JS的时候,遇到过在循环中使用匿名函数时,程序运行的结果并不是按照我们想象的循环依次进行,当时随便在网上查了查,然后照着用IIFE方式解决了,但是一直没有去深入研究内部的原因。今天总算清闲下来,从JS中的闭包,一直到IIFE都细细理了一遍,这篇博文先总结下闭包的用法。文中部分内容引用了其他页面,会在最后统一引用说明。引言我们先来看一下我出现问题的代码,因为我的代码和项目结合较高

2017-02-22 16:34:32 493

原创 jQuery标签选择器使用

1.jQuery获取表单的全部数据。       jQuery序列化表单数据 可以使用serialize()和 serializeArray()。它们的区别如下:(1).serialize()方法   格式:var data= $("form").serialize();   功能:将表单内容序列化成一个字符串。这样在ajax提交表单数据时,就不用一一列举出每一个参数。

2016-12-29 15:28:48 3863

原创 dot.js异步加载数据

1引入cdnhttps://cdnjs.com/libraries/dot2如何使用dot.js分为三部分:第一部分表示,你要动态添加的html代码位置。第二部分表示,你要动态拼接的html标签和数据格式。第三部分表示,dot.js获取后台传递的json数组,和html标签进行拼接,并添加到第一部分的位置。需要注意的地方:(1)   这里的i

2016-12-28 17:56:08 1056 1

原创 jquery常用操作说明

jquery常用操作说明1.如何引入jquery    要使用jQuery,我们要知道,jQuery是一个函数库,简单来讲就是一个后缀名为".js"的文件。可以在http://www.bootcdn.cn/jquery/ ,复制链接引入CDN。 2.怎么初始化    jQuery 页面加载初始化的方法有3种 ,页面在加载的时候都会执行脚本,应该没什么区别,主要看习惯

2016-12-27 18:51:54 253

转载 jQuery 序列化表单 serialize()和serializeArray()使用方法

问题描述:jquery serialize用于将表单内容序列化成一个字符串,serialize经常用在表单AJAX提交过程中。serializeArray方法用于将页面表单序列化成一个JSON结构的对象,注意不是JSON字符串。本文章通过实例向大家讲解jQuery serialize()和serializeArray()使用方法。需要的码农可以参考一下。问题分析:1.s

2016-12-01 10:12:22 532

转载 JQuery onload、ready概念介绍及使用方法

问题描述页面加载完成有两种事件,一是ready,表示文档结构已经加载完成,onload,ready概念容易混淆,下面为大家详细介绍下页面加载完成有两种事件,一是ready,表示文档结构已经加载完成(不包含图片等非文字媒体文件),二是onload,指示页 面包含图片等文件在内的所有元素都加载完成。(可以说:ready 在onload 前加载!!!)问题分析一般样式控制的,

2016-11-23 23:14:19 316

转载 jquery $.each用法

问题描述:jQuery提供的each方法是对参数一提供的对象的中所有的子元素逐一进行方法调用。而jQuery对象提供的each方法则是对jQuery内 部的子元素进行逐个调用。他的用法如下。问题分析:1、遍历对象(有附加参数)$.each(Object, function(p1, p2) { this; //这里的this指向每次遍历中Object

2016-11-23 22:58:24 212

转载 PHP中的排序函数sort、asort、rsort、krsort、ksort区别分析

问题描述:在php中自带了大量了数组排序函数,下面我们一一来介绍一下关于php数组排序的用法吧。       sort() 函数用于对数组单元从低到高进行排序。  rsort() 函数用于对数组单元从高到低进行排序。  asort() 函数用于对数组单元从低到高进行排序并保持索引关系。  arsort() 函数用于对数组单元从高到低进行排序并保持索引关系。  ksort()

2016-11-14 22:49:59 320

转载 PHP 四种基本排序算法的代码实现

问题描述许多人都说算法是程序的核心,算法的好坏决定了程序的质量。作为一个初级phper,虽然很少接触到算法方面的东西。但是对于基本的排序算法还是应该掌握的,它是程序开发的必备工具。这里介绍冒泡排序,插入排序,选择排序,快速排序四种基本算法,分析一下算法的思路。前提:分别用冒泡排序法,快速排序法,选择排序法,插入排序法将下面数组中的值按照从小到大的顺序进行排序。$arr(1,

2016-11-07 22:55:42 322

原创 php foreach 简介和引用时需要注意的事项

问题描述foreach 仅能用于数组,非常方便。有两种语法,第二种比较次要但却是第一种的有用的扩展。foreach (array_expression as $value) statement foreach (array_expression as $key => $value) statementforeach虽然简单,不过它可能会出现一些意外的行为,特别是代码涉及

2016-11-04 07:33:04 245

原创 php大转盘抽奖算法

问题描述:   现在的营销工具大部分都包含抽奖部分,例如大转盘,刮刮卡等。虽然在前端显示的效果完全不同,但是从发出抽奖请求,到返回抽奖结果直接php部分可以通用。整个流程包括 1拼装奖项数组2进行概率计算3返回中奖情况(包括是否中奖,奖品编号,奖品名称,奖品图片,奖品类型等)。问题分析:(1)拼装奖项数组//奖品数组 $prize_arr = array(

2016-10-25 10:02:53 2631

转载 php日期转时间戳,指定日期转换成时间戳

问题描述UNIX时间戳和格式化日期是我们常打交道的两个时间表示形式,Unix时间戳存储、处理方便,但是不直观,格式化日期直观,但是处理起来不如Unix时间戳那么自如,所以有的时候需要互相转换,下面给出互相转换的几种转换方式。解决办法checkdate($month,$date,$year)   如果应用的值构成一个有效日期,则该函数返回为真。例如,对于错误日期2005年2月

2016-10-11 23:10:30 3150

转载 Jquery中$.get(),$.post(),$.ajax(),$.getJSON()的用法总结

原文地址:     http://www.jb51.net/article/43194.htm详细解读Jquery各Ajax函数:$.get(),$.post(),$.ajax(),$.getJSON()一,$.get(url,[data],[callback])说明:url为请求地址,data为请求数据的列表,callback为请求成功后的回调函数,该函数接受两个

2016-09-28 23:49:18 278

转载 jquery与php交互的方法,通过json格式

之所以要用到Json,很多时候是因为使用ajax对象时,程序与JS函数之间的数据交互。因为JS不认识PHP中的数组,PHP也不认识JS中的数组或对象。Json很好的解决了这个问题。Json简介J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式。它基于JavaScript的一个子集,这意味着JavaScript可以直接读取Json

2016-09-25 15:42:13 799

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除